Narcotica Podcast

Narcotica Podcast

Episode 77: Harm Production — The Hazards of Drug Courts with Dave Lucas

September 07, 2022

The United States sure loves to cage people. Incarceration statistics can be shocking, but they can be cited so often that they can lose their potency. It can seem abstract or just the way things are.